Trump confirms his conversation with his Chinese counterpart, while the latter denies it.

In response to a question about whether he had spoken with Xi after announcing his tariff plan, he told reporters, "I don't want to comment on that, but I have spoken to him many times."
Trump made these comments following the publication of an interview with Time magazine in which he said that the Chinese president had called him.
In response to this, Trump said he will provide more details "at the appropriate time."
Trump mentioned in the interview that his administration is in talks with China to reach an agreement on tariffs.
Trump told reporters as he left the White House to attend Pope Francis's funeral last Saturday that his administration is very close to reaching an agreement on tariffs with Japan.
He added, "Trade agreements are going well."
